Redson Munlo Resigns from MCP
Published on January 6, 2026 at 11:18 AM by Edgar Naitha
Redson Munlo, a known member of the Malawi Congress Party (MCP), has resigned from the party.
Speaking at a news briefing in Blantyre on Wednesday morning, Munlo said his decision to quit MCP was personal.
“I have stopped partisan politics but remain politically conscious,” he said.
Munlo, a politician and activist, joined MCP at a rally addressed by former president Dr. Lazarus Chakwera.
Meanwhile, MCP Deputy Spokesperson Ken Nsonda is yet to comment on the development.
